How do I move the old address book from a renamed personal folders file into
the new personal folders file. The old file had become corrupted and I
couldn't download new messages so had to create a new file. Works fine now,
but no entries are in the address book.
Russ Valentine [MVP-Outlook] - 14 Jan 2006 10:19 GMT
There is no address book in Outlook. All data is in your Contacts Folder.
All you need to do is configure your Outlook Address Book. Method depends on
your Outlook version which you neglected to post. Since there are thousands
of posts on how to do this in this group, just find one that fits your
version.
